A drunkard

LADY WISHFORT. Offence! as I'm a person, I'm ashamed of you—foh! how you stink of wine! D'ye think my niece will ever endure such a borachio! you're an absolute borachio.

A bottle for wine made of pigskin

Meer. Yes, / But by my way of dressing, you must know, sir, / And med'cining the leather to a height / Of improved ware, like your borachio / Of Spain, sir, I can fetch nine thousand for't.

{n} a drunkard, a leathern bottle

    () From Spanish borracho (“drunkard, wine bottle”) > Latin burrus (“red, flushed”) > Ancient Greek πυρρός (pyrrhos, “tawny, red”)
